#173c2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#173c2e is composed of 9% red, 23.5%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.3% yellow and 76.5% black. It has a hue angle of 157.3 degrees, a saturation of 44.6% and a lightness of 16.3%. #173c2e color hex could be obtained by blending #2e785c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#173c2e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010303 is the darkest color, while #f4fb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#173c2e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#272c2a is the less saturated color, while #015233 is the most saturated one.
